χᾰριεντ-ισμός

charientismos · ὁ

wit

Generated live from the audited corpus — every figure on this page is a database query, not prose from memory.

Where it lives

  • Theaetetus 1 · 0.44/10k
  • Republic 1 · 0.11/10k

What it meant — LSJ

wit

wit, Pl. Tht. 168d; χ. καὶ εὐτραπελία Id. R. 563a; opp. σπουδή, Plu. Lib.educ. 2.11e; χ. ἐν σπουδῇ γενόμενος D.H. Isoc. 12; including a vein of irony, coupled with δριμύτης, Hermog. Id. 2.5.
